Analysis

The most recent figure for meat of pig with the bone, fresh or chilled (indigenous) — gross in Croatia is 174,064 1000 USD, measured in 2017.

The figure is up 27.8% on the previous year and down 10.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, meat of pig with the bone, fresh or chilled (indigenous) — gross in Croatia peaked at 1.28 million 1000 USD in 1992 and was at its lowest, 93,491 1000 USD, in 2000.

That places Croatia 51st out of 124 countries with data for 2017,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Meat of pig with the bone, fresh or chilled (indigenous) — Gross in Croatia, year by year

Annual values for Meat of pig with the bone, fresh or chilled (indigenous) — Gross Production Value (current thousand US$) in Croatia, 1992 to 2017.
Year 1000 USD Change
1992 1.28 million 1000 USD
1993 139,619 1000 USD -89.1%
1994 121,626 1000 USD -12.9%
1995 133,899 1000 USD +10.1%
1996 125,528 1000 USD -6.3%
1997 123,666 1000 USD -1.5%
1998 125,254 1000 USD +1.3%
1999 107,517 1000 USD -14.2%
2000 93,491 1000 USD -13.0%
2001 108,020 1000 USD +15.5%
2002 104,288 1000 USD -3.5%
2003 95,153 1000 USD -8.8%
2004 147,459 1000 USD +55.0%
2005 205,507 1000 USD +39.4%
2006 173,404 1000 USD -15.6%
2007 194,896 1000 USD +12.4%
2008 206,946 1000 USD +6.2%
2009 211,426 1000 USD +2.2%
2010 156,805 1000 USD -25.8%
2011 180,033 1000 USD +14.8%
2012 215,191 1000 USD +19.5%
2013 204,247 1000 USD -5.1%
2014 182,577 1000 USD -10.6%
2015 117,032 1000 USD -35.9%
2016 136,189 1000 USD +16.4%
2017 174,064 1000 USD +27.8%
